Nekonvenční metody obrábění materiálu
LARVA, Jaroslav
The bachelor thesis deals with the summary and characteristics of unconventional machining methods used in mechanical engineering for the agricultural or automotive industry, such as chemical, electrochemical machining, electroerosive machining, ultrasonic machining, laser machining or electro beam machining. The first part includes a systematic division and characteristics of individual methods. For each method, the history, machining principle, machining equipment, advantages and typical area of application of individual unconventional technologies in technical practice are described. The final chapter contains a comparison of individual methods depending on the achieved surface quality and dimensional tolerance.
